Both the Greek salad ($11) and the supreme pizza ($19) were delicious. Lots of flavor. If you like very plain food you may not like this- we like our food well-seasoned and it was perfect.
I should have asked for marinara or some kind of sauce on the side to dip our crust in. Next time.
Side salads weren’t an option. (Whyyyy?) It was one of the best salads we’ve had in a long time. Waitress brought us an extra plate so we could share a regular size salad.
Service is semi-wait staff, semi self-serve.
Employees were polite. Service was fast- not like the $6 hot n ready pizza place- but this is far better quality than those places and our pizza was brought to the table piping hot and loaded worth toppings.
Restaurant was clean. There’s a viewing area where you can watch the pizza being made- fun for kids.
With the name “Post Game”, we were surprised by the quietness – No music or anything- just peace and quiet. We were grateful for a peaceful dinner. It may not always be like that- this was late evening.
Do wish the TV (volume muted) wasn’t showing a gross bloody sweaty boxing match while we were eating lol. I do get that it goes with the theme so not really a complaint, just would have preferred to watch sweaty, non-bloody baseball haha.
For delicious pizza- 100% Recommend! We left stuffed!
Will be back when in the area.
If they ever get a salad bar with the same freshness of the salad we had tonight, we would make excuses to be in the area a lot more often.
